BSOD on Toshiba laptop with 8 Gb but not with 4 Gb
Hi everyone,
I have a Toshiba laptop L850-138 with Win 7 Home Premium SP1 64 bits.
Around 6 months ago I replaced the original Samsung memory for a 2x 4Gb Corsair kit with same specs.
No problems until this last month when I'm getting several random BSODs, 99% caused by ntoskrnl.exe.
When I get a BSOD I'm unable to boot again until I take off one RAM module. With 4GB works fine.
But sometimes I put again both modules and runs stable for several days... until I get a BSOD again.
I have changed of place both modules, cleaning contacts, etc.
I have updated BIOS, drivers, programs. I have run SFC, Windows Memory Diagnostic, etc.
I have uninstalled Avira and replaced by MSE. I have scanned with MBAM, SuperAntispyware, anti-rootkits, etc.
I have run memtest86+ (not much passes but no errors found).
The only thing I have not tried yet is reinstalling the system but I would like to find the problem before.
